For this photoshoot, they chose to be in their Dallas home. This is an option that can highlight the living environment of the family and show off some comfortable kids in their favorite play areas. Something to keep in mind if you want a home shoot is the natural light: is there plenty of it? I bring some extra lights, but I need a naturally bright space to capture the best toddler photos.

Another thing to consider for an in-home photo shoot is where you want the pictures taken. We shot photos in the living room, master bedroom, kids’ room, bathroom, and backyard.
